Documents the results of the inspection

During a Gas Safety Inspection, a certified Engineer records the results of an installation or appliance. The results are recorded on the Gas Safe Certificate. This document contains essential information about the inspection, including the date, address, and description of the property. It also identifies any safety defects and recommends the necessary steps to correct them. The certificate also includes the signature, name and Gas Safe registration numbers of the person who conducted the inspection.

Landlords must have an official gas safety certificate for each gas appliance they have in their rental property. The certificate must be renewed every year. These certificates are vital for landlords in order to avoid expensive fines, and also to ensure that their appliances are safe. This is why it's crucial to understand what is a CP12 contains and how to get gas safety certificate to interpret it.

The top left corner of the CP12 document has the name of the engineer and his registration number that can be checked against the engineer's Gas Safe record. Below the box, there are two boxes, one for the specifics of a property being inspected and the other for the name of the landlord or their representative. The bottom left of the certificate lists the inspection result, whether Pass or Fail. There is also room for the engineer to record the date of the next inspection.

The Gas Safety Certificate (CP12) contains information like the name and ID number for the person who is inspecting the property, address, a list and location of all gas appliances and whether they are safe to use (pass or fail). It also provides details of any issues found in appliances that are not suitable to use. The appliances that are damaged are classified as ID or AR and must be repaired immediately to avoid any accidents or injuries.
